## Releases

Welcome aboard! Quieten, our on-call alert deduplicator, ships every other Thursday. We cut a tag from main, run the smoke suite against the Farwick staging cluster, and push artifacts to the internal registry. If you're doing the release, ping whoever's on rotation first — usually Marla or Deet — so nobody double-cuts. Hotfixes skip the schedule but still need a signed build; unsigned tarballs get rejected at deploy time, no exceptions. To verify any release artifact locally, use the current signing key below.

signing key of yagug-bawif = bky9_cvCf6ehGp

Subject: Inkwell markdown pipeline 5.1 deployed

On-call: the Inkwell rendering pipeline is now on 5.1 in production. Changes: sanitizer runs before the table parser, footnote rendering is cached per document, and the fallback plain-text path no longer strips headings. If render latency alarms fire, roll back via the standard script — it handles cache invalidation. Known issue: nested blockquotes over six levels render flat. The deployment trace token follows.

build token for hawep-kageg: htk14_558814e2114cc7

TICKET GH-4471 — Humidity sensor drift, Bay 3

Severity: medium. Thornfield controller in Bay 3 reporting humidity 6–8% above reference probe after ~10 days uptime. Drift resets on reboot, returns gradually. Suspect the averaging buffer in the polling loop never evicts stale samples. Contractor notes: do not recalibrate the physical sensors — hardware has been verified against the lab reference twice. Repro: leave controller running 72h, compare against handheld meter. Logs attached to this ticket. The affected controller build is listed below.

session token of yajof-bagef = htk4_937d

**Tallygrid — Environments: Export Memory**

This page documents memory controls for Tallygrid's spreadsheet export workers across environments. Production enforces stricter per-job ceilings than staging to prevent oversized exports from starving neighboring tenants; limits were tuned after the March load review. The production environment currently runs with the following values.

deployment values, yadug-bawif:
[framir]
team = pelox
access_code = ac_a38ab2
owner = tamion.julael
host = framir.tolvaqlabs.test
port = 11211
peer = tammir.zemvargrid.local
salt = 2215ef03
pin = 1541